Systems, methods and devices for creating an effect using microwave energy to specified tissue are disclosed. A system for the application of microwave energy to a tissue includes a signal generator adapted to generate a microwave signal having predetermined characteristics, an applicator connected to the generator and adapted to apply microwave energy to tissue. The applicator includes one or more microwave antennas and a tissue interface, a vacuum source connected to the tissue interface, a cooling source connected to the tissue interface, and a controller adapted to control the signal generator, the vacuum source, and the coolant source. The tissue includes a first layer and a second layer, the second layer below the first layer. The controller is configured so that the system delivers energy such that a peak power loss density profile is created in the second layer.

A method of creating a lesion in a dermal layer of skin wherein the skin has at least a dermal layer and a sub-dermal layer, the method comprising the steps of: positioning a device adapted to radiate microwave energy adjacent an external surface of the skin;radiating microwave energy having an electric field component which is substantially parallel to a region of the external surface of the skin above the dermal layer, wherein the microwave energy has a frequency which generates a standing wave pattern of microwave energy in the dermal layer, the standing wave pattern having a constructive interference peak in the dermal layer proximal to an interface between the dermal layer and the sub-dermal layer; andheating a portion of the dermal region in close proximity to the interface using the radiated microwave energy to create the lesion. 2. The method of claim 1, wherein the microwave energy radiates in a TEM mode. 3. The method of claim 1, wherein the microwave energy has a frequency of approximately 5.8GHz. 4. The method of claim 1, wherein the microwave energy generates heat in the target tissue by dielectric heating. 5. The method of claim 2, wherein the electromagnetic energy radiates in a TE10 mode. 6. A method of heating a sweat gland located in or near an interface between a dermal layer and sub-dermal layer in skin, wherein the dermal layer consists of a first, upper dermal layer and a second, lower dermal layer, the upper dermal layer being adjacent a skin surface, the method comprising the steps of: irradiating the upper dermal layer and the lower dermal layer through the skin surface with electromagnetic energy having predetermined frequency and electric field characteristics; andgenerating a power loss density profile wherein the power loss density profile has a peak power loss density in the lower dermal layer. 7. The method of claim 6, wherein the power loss density is generated by a standing wave pattern of electromagnetic energy having a single peak in the lower dermal layer. 8. The method of claim 7, wherein the standing wave pattern is created by the reflection of at least a portion of the electromagnetic energy off of the interface. 9. The method of claim 8, wherein the standing wave pattern has a constructive interference peak in the lower dermal layer. 10. The method of claim 9, wherein the upper dermal layer is protected by cooling the outer surface of the skin. 11. The method of claim 10, wherein tissue, including sweat glands are heated by heat generated in the region of dermis having the peak power loss density. 12. The method of claim 11, wherein heating the sweat glands results in a reduction in the symptoms of hyperhidrosis. 13. A method of raising the temperature of at least a portion of a tissue structure located below an interface between a dermal layer and sub-dermal layer in skin, the dermal layer having an upper portion adjacent an external surface of the skin and a lower portion adjacent a sub-dermal region of the skin, the method comprising the steps of: radiating the skin with microwave energy having a predetermined power, frequency and e-field orientation;generating a peak energy density region in the lower portion of the dermal layer;initiating a lesion in the peak energy density region by dielectric heating of tissue in the peak energy density region;enlarging the lesion, wherein the lesion is enlarged, at least in part, by conduction of heat from the peak energy density region to surrounding tissue;removing heat from the skin surface and at least a portion of the upper portion of the dermal layer; andcontinuing to radiate the skin with the microwave energy for a time sufficient to extend the lesion past the interface and into the sub-dermal layer. 14. The method of claim 13, wherein the e-field component of the microwave energy is substantially parallel to at least a portion of the skin surface through which the e-field passes. 15. The method of claim 13, wherein the energy density region results from a standing wave pattern of microwave energy generated by reflection of at least a portion of the microwave energy off an interface between a dermal and hypodermal layer. 16. The method of claim 15, wherein the standing wave pattern has a constructive interference minimum in the first tissue layer. 17. The method of claim 13, wherein the frequency is between approximately 5 GHz and 6.5 GHz. 18. The method of claim 17, wherein the frequency is approximately 5.8 GHz. 19. The method of claim 13, wherein the tissue structure is a sweat gland.
